web学习笔记(八十三)git

目录

1.Git的基本概念

2.gitee常用的命令

3.解决两个人操作不同文件造成的冲突

4.解决两个人操作同一个文件造成的冲突


1.Git的基本概念

git是一种管理代码的方式,广泛用于软件开发和版本管理。我们通常使用gitee(码云)来云管理代码。

2.gitee常用的命令

克隆仓库 git clone <仓库地址>(推荐复制ssh格式的地址)
添加文件到暂存区git add <文件名>(也可以git add  .直接将所有的文件添加到缓存区)
提交到本地仓库 git commit -m "提交信息"
推送到远程仓库 git push origin <分支名>(如果直接 git push则会更新到当前默认分支)
拉取远程仓库的更新 git pull origin <分支名>
查看当前分支状态  git status
查看提交历史 git log
创建新分支 git branch <分支名>
切换分支 git checkout <分支名>
合并分支  git merge <分支名>
添加标签git tag <标签名>
查看远程仓库信息  git remote -v

3.解决两个人操作不同文件造成的冲突

解决方法:

(1)先通过git pull下拉项目,

(2)填一个新的commit信息用于合并冲突的commit 

点一下i进入编辑模式 输入:解决提交冲突。再点一下esc退出编译模式,再通过shift+zz来保存

(3)通过git status来查看当前分支状态。没有异常就可以继续重新提交

如何避免这个错误:

在每次提交之前先通过git pull先下拉项目,保证本地项目和云项目是一样的,然后再通过(1)git add . (2)git commit -m "提交信息" (3)git push来提交项目。

4.解决两个人操作同一个文件造成的冲突

两个人操作同一个文件造成的冲突一般会显示在项目中,此时我们可以直接选择保留双方的更改来解决这个冲突。然后再重新提交

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://xiahunao.cn/news/3268245.html

如若内容造成侵权/违法违规/事实不符,请联系瞎胡闹网进行投诉反馈,一经查实,立即删除!

相关文章

鸿蒙(API 12 Beta2版)【创建NDK工程】

创建NDK工程 下面通过DevEco Studio的NDK工程模板&#xff0c;来演示如何创建一个NDK工程。 说明 不同DevEco Studio版本的向导界面、模板默认参数等会有所不同&#xff0c;请根据实际工程需要&#xff0c;创建工程或修改工程参数。 通过如下两种方式&#xff0c;打开工程创…

【资料分享】2024钉钉杯大数据挑战赛A题思路解析+代码演示

2024第三届钉钉杯大学生大数据挑战赛今天已经开赛&#xff0c;【A题】思路解析代码&#xff0c;资料预览&#xff1a;

【数据结构】二叉树链式结构——感受递归的暴力美学

前言&#xff1a; 在上篇文章【数据结构】二叉树——顺序结构——堆及其实现中&#xff0c;实现了二叉树的顺序结构&#xff0c;使用堆来实现了二叉树这样一个数据结构&#xff1b;现在就来实现而二叉树的链式结构。 一、链式结构 链式结构&#xff0c;使用链表来表示一颗二叉树…

Python 爬虫入门(一):从零开始学爬虫 「详细介绍」

Python 爬虫入门&#xff08;一&#xff09;&#xff1a;从零开始学爬虫 「详细介绍」 前言1.爬虫概念1.1 什么是爬虫&#xff1f;1.2 爬虫的工作原理 2. HTTP 简述2.1 什么是 HTTP&#xff1f;2.2 HTTP 请求2.3 HTTP 响应2.4 常见的 HTTP 方法 3. 网页的组成3.1 HTML3.1.1 HTM…

【MATLAB源码-第238期】基于simulink的三输出单端反激flyback仿真,通过PWM和PID控制能够得到稳定电压。

操作环境&#xff1a; MATLAB 2022a 1、算法描述 概述 反激变换器是一种广泛应用于电源管理的拓扑结构&#xff0c;特别是在需要隔离输入和输出的应用中。它的工作原理是利用变压器的储能和释放能量来实现电压转换和隔离。该图展示了一个通过脉宽调制&#xff08;PWM&#…

基于springboot+vue+uniapp的居民健康监测小程序

开发语言&#xff1a;Java框架&#xff1a;springbootuniappJDK版本&#xff1a;JDK1.8服务器&#xff1a;tomcat7数据库&#xff1a;mysql 5.7&#xff08;一定要5.7版本&#xff09;数据库工具&#xff1a;Navicat11开发软件&#xff1a;eclipse/myeclipse/ideaMaven包&#…

【初阶数据结构】9.二叉树(4)

文章目录 5.二叉树算法题5.1 单值二叉树5.2 相同的树5.3 另一棵树的子树5.4 二叉树遍历5.5 二叉树的构建及遍历 6.二叉树选择题 5.二叉树算法题 5.1 单值二叉树 点击链接做题 代码&#xff1a; /*** Definition for a binary tree node.* struct TreeNode {* int val;* …

虚拟机centos9搭建wordpress

目录 1. 更换yum源更新系统软件包&#xff1a; 1.1备份yum源 1.1.1创建备份目录&#xff1a; 1.1.2移动现有仓库配置文件到备份目录&#xff1a; 1.1.3验证备份&#xff1a; 1.2更换yum源 1.2.1添加yum源 1.2.2删除和建立yum缓存 1.3更新系统软件包 1.4 yum与dnf介绍…

谷粒商城实战笔记-62-商品服务-API-品牌管理-OSS整合测试

文章目录 一&#xff0c;Java中上传文件到阿里云OSS1&#xff0c;整合阿里云OSS2&#xff0c;测试上传文件 二&#xff0c;Java中整合阿里云OSS服务指南引言准备工作1. 注册阿里云账号2. 获取Access Key3. 添加依赖 实现OSS客户端1. 初始化OSSClient2. 创建Bucket3. 上传文件4.…

nginx的学习(二):负载均衡和动静分离

简介 nginx的负载均衡和动静分离的简单使用 负载均衡配置 外部访问linux的ip地址:80/edu/a.html地址&#xff0c;会轮询访问Tomcat8080和Tomcat8081服务。 Tomcat的准备 准备两个Tomcat&#xff0c;具体准备步骤在nginx的学习一的反向代理例子2中&#xff0c;在Tomcat8080…

告别繁琐地推!Xinstall如何一键优化你的App地推方案

在这个移动应用遍地开花的时代&#xff0c;App地推活动早已成为各大厂商获取新用户、提升品牌曝光度的重要手段。然而&#xff0c;传统地推方案中的种种弊端&#xff0c;如填写地推码/邀请码的繁琐、渠道打包的工作量繁重、人工登记上报的不准确等&#xff0c;无一不在拖慢地推…

【接口设计】学会用 RestTemplate 发请求

《接口设计》系列&#xff0c;共包含以下 5 篇文章&#xff1a; 前后端的通信方式 REST如何设计统一 RESTful 风格的数据接口为 APP、PC、H5 网页提供统一风格的 API&#xff08;实战篇&#xff0c;附源码地址&#xff09;用 Swagger 实现接口文档学会用 RestTemplate 发请求 …

【C++】选择结构案例-三目运算符

三目运算符语法格式&#xff1a; 布尔表达式?表达式1:表达式2 运算过程&#xff1a;如果布尔表达式的值为 true &#xff0c;则返回 表达式1 的值&#xff0c;否则返回 表达式2 的值 &#xff08;三目运算符指的是&#xff1f;和&#xff1a;&#xff09; 在这个三目运算符…

USB转多路串口-纯硬件实现串口数据传输指示灯电路

前言 串口相关产品往往要求有数据收发时LED闪烁&#xff0c;我们经常会用软件实现&#xff0c;在MCU内注册一个定时器&#xff0c;有数据发送时就闪烁一段时间。软件点灯这种方式存在两个缺陷&#xff0c;一是接收方向不好实现&#xff1b;二是定时器一般用固定频率&#xff0…

Redis的两种持久化方式---RDB、AOF

rdb其实就是一种快照持久化的方式&#xff0c;它会将Redis在某个时间点的所有的数据状态以二进制的方式保存到硬盘上的文件当中&#xff0c;它相对于aof文件会小很多&#xff0c;因为知识某个时间点的数据&#xff0c;当然&#xff0c;这就会导致它的实时性不够高&#xff0c;如…

Nature Electronics|柔性可吞服电子设备用于胃部电生理学监测(柔性健康监测/可吞服电子/柔性

美国麻省理工学院David H. Koch 综合癌症研究所的 Giovanni Traverso团队,在《Nature Electronics》上发布了一篇题为“An ingestible device for gastric electrophysiology”的论文。论文内容如下: 一、 摘要 从胃肠道和肠道神经系统记录高质量电生理数据的能力有助于了解…

信通院发布!首个大模型混合云标准

近日&#xff0c;中国信通院发布了首个大模型混合云标准&#xff0c;通过定位当前大模型混合云的能力水平&#xff0c;为基于混合云的大模型服务实践提供指引&#xff0c;并明确未来提升方向。同时&#xff0c;中国信通院基于标准展开大模型混合云能力成熟度专项测试&#xff0…

生信技能54 - WisecondorX多线程并行分析CNV

WisecondorX分析CNV,默认单样本分析,batch_analysis参数设置为True可启动多样本并行分析。 WisecondorX基本使用方法以及npz文件转换和reference构建参考文章: 生信技能53 - wiseconrdoX自动化批量npz转换和reference构建 github: https://github.com/CenterForMedicalGe…

Windows 安装 PostgreSQL 并安装 vector 扩展

目录 前言 下载安装 pgAdmin 4 vector 扩展 前言 调研大模型时&#xff0c;了解到一些大模型的应用&#xff0c;其中一个就是知识库&#xff0c;用户可以上传文档到知识库中&#xff0c;系统解析文档并将内容向量化保存起来&#xff0c;以便在和模型交互时使用。 在和大模…

【MySQL进阶之路 | 高级篇】数据操作类型的角度理解共享锁,排他锁

1. 从数据操作的类型划分&#xff1a;读锁&#xff0c;写锁 对于数据库并发事务的读-读情况并不会引起什么问题。对于写-写&#xff0c;读-写操作或写-写操作这些情况可能会引起一些问题&#xff0c;需要使用MVCC或者加锁的方式来解决它们。在使用加锁的方式解决问题时&#x…